Still perfect: Team LeBron wins NBA All-Star Game

PHOTO: AP ATLANTA Even in the strangest NBA All-Star Game of them all, LeBron James was still the perfect captain. Team LeBron showed off its high-flying and long-range skills during a dominating run to close out the first half, setting up a 170-150 romp over Team Durant in the league s 70th midseason showcase Sunday night (Monday, Manila time). This one sure was different than the previous 69 All-Star contests. Determined to pull off an exhibition that is huge for TV revenue and the league s worldwide brand, the NBA staged the game in a mostly empty arena in downtown Atlanta, a made-for-TV extravaganza that was symbolic of the coronavirus era.

Robert Covington falls short in NBA All-Star Skills Challenge, still comes up big for Tennessee State students

Robert Covington falls short in NBA All-Star Skills Challenge, still comes up big for Tennessee State students Updated Mar 07, 2021; Posted Mar 07, 2021 ATLANTA, GEORGIA - MARCH 07: Robert Covington of the Portland Trail Blazers competes in the 2021 NBA All-Star - Taco Bell Skills Challenge during All-Star Sunday Night at State Farm Arena on March 07, 2021 in Atlanta, Georgia. (Photo by Kevin C. Cox/Getty Images)Getty Images Facebook Share The Portland Trail Blazers didn’t have the strongest start to NBA All-Star Weekend festivities at State Farm Arena in Atlanta. Participating in the 19th Taco Bell Skills Challenge on Sunday, veteran Blazers forward Robert Covington was among the first players to be eliminated in the competition. The eight-year pro was bested by Orlando Magic big Nikola Vucevic in the first-round of the obstacle-course challenge that tests players’ skills in dribbling, passing, agility and 3-point shooting.

ASU seeks votes in Home Depot s Retool Your School competition

ASU seeks votes in Home Depot’s ‘Retool Your School’ competition ASU seeks votes in Home Depot’s ‘Retool Your School’ competition By Bethany Davis | March 8, 2021 at 6:07 AM CST - Updated March 8 at 9:56 AM MONTGOMERY, Ala. (WSFA) - Alabama State University needs your vote to make some much-needed improvements on campus. ASU along with 61 other Historically Black Colleges and Universities are competing to receive one of 30 grants from Home Depot. The grant money ranges from $20,000 to $75,000 per school The competition is called “Retool your School”. Since Home Depot started this program in 2009, it has provided more than 117 sustainable campus improvement grants for 87 percent of the nation’s HBCUs.
